Sabotage from one pilot to another? Pau Navarrocategory leader challengerI guarantee someone was able to disconnect the accelerator cable before the start of stage 10.

This is what the electricians on his team told him, and they were confident that it would be impossible for that cable to break on its own. pole and his co-pilot, Jan Rosathey imagined that something had recently happened to them and that they might be in first place in the general classification, which is why Jean decided to stand guard all night in the shelter camp of the marathon stage and sleep under the car in case someone approached his car.

The next day, his car stopped about 3 kilometers after leaving the bivouac. Many pilots stopped there to help, but were unable to locate the defective cable. Later, a pilot from his team arrived and suggested they examine the connector. He got it right.

Pau was able to take the stage and maintain the lead, but cut the lead from 41 minutes to the current 18 minutes. This issue resulted in him receiving a 12-minute penalty for being late for the start of the time special.
